There is no more critical variable than governance, for it is governance that determines whether there are durable links between the State and the society it purports to govern.
The nature of governance is central because it determines whether the exercise of authority is viewed as legitimate. Legitimate authority, in turn, is based on accepted laws and norms rather than the arbitrary, unconstrained power of the rulers.
